Classic & Traditional Arabic Ramadan Greetings (With Translations)

These are the timeless greetings you'll hear throughout the month. Using them is a beautiful way to honor tradition and offer a universally understood blessing.
1. رمضان مبارك (Ramadan Mubarak)
- *Translation:* Blessed Ramadan. This is the most common and wonderful greeting to wish someone a blessed and prosperous month.
2. رمضان كريم (Ramadan Kareem)
- *Translation:* Generous Ramadan. This greeting wishes that Ramadan may be generous to the person, reflecting the month's spirit of giving.
3. كل عام وأنتم بخير (Kul 'aam wa antum bi'khayr)
- *Translation:* May you be well every year. A beautiful, all-purpose greeting used for many happy occasions, including Ramadan.
4. تقبل الله منا ومنكم صالح الأعمال (Taqabbal Allahu minna wa minkum salih al-a'mal)
- *Translation:* May Allah accept from us and from you the righteous deeds. This is a profound wish for one's acts of worship to be accepted.
5. عساكم من عواده (Asakum min awadah)
- *Translation:* May you be among those who witness it again. This expresses the hope that you and the recipient will be alive and well to see many more Ramadans.
6. مبارك عليكم الشهر (Mubarak alaikum al-shahr)
- *Translation:* Blessed be the month upon you. A lovely and slightly more formal way to wish blessings for Ramadan.
7. أتمنى لكم رمضان مبارك (Atamanna lakum Ramadan Mubarak)
- *Translation:* I wish you a blessed Ramadan. A simple, direct, and heartfelt way to share your good wishes.
